The Company Shuttle unit of Hupac Intermodal serves customers who charter their own trains and secure capacity at an attractive price. Each company shuttle runs exclusively for up to three partners who take on the full loading commitment. Your advantages:

  • customised schedules meeting your specific needs
  • cost effective with fully automated standard procedures
  • procurement power of a strong partner.

Trains are our job. We provide our know-how to ensure that your trains are an instant success. From purchasing railway services and operational control of the day-to-day business to taking action in case of disturbances and wagon management – we act as an interface to the railways and free you up to focus on your core business.

 

Tailor-made to satisfy highest expectations

Each train is individually arranged to meet the customer’s needs. Based on the required route, schedule and frequency, we evaluate the needed components and define the required service level. For example, the package may comprise:

  • wagon rental and fleet management
  • terminal services
  • train monitoring and operational control 24/7
  • backup wagons or compositions
  • further added value services such as positioning of empty equipment, in-plant services, etc.

Integrated order management

Orders are processed efficiently. We install a customised order-to-billing system for each train with effective IT integration between the customer’s ERP software and Hupac’s operating system.

Traffic ban in Denmark: alternative solutions for intermodal transport

On 22 January 2021 the Danish Safety Authority has banned the circulation of semitrailers on pocket wagons on the Danish railway network. The trigger for this decision was the report of a semi-trailer that was not correctly anchored in its pocket wagon while crossing the Storebælt Bridge by train.

 

The traffic ban has a validity of 14 days. Technical investigations are in progress.

 

In order to maintain the traffic in this difficult environment, Hupac foresees short term gateway solution to/from Taulov for containers and swap bodies as of week 4. If needed, alternative solutions for trailers with rerouting from/to Hamburg and other terminals close to the German-Danish border will be set up.

 

It is now crucial to fully understand the underlying reasons for the reported situation and to introduce appropriate measures. Hupac is available to support the European process of technical analysis and to share its know-how.

 

The Hupac Group has a fleet of about 3.400 pocket wagons and carries around 200.000 semitrailers per year. The current technology of fixing the semitrailer on the wagon is similar to the technology adopted for fixing the semitrailer on the truck. It is the result of decades of experience and can be considered as safe.
